While sorting through old papers tonight, I found these quotes from Rainer Maria Rilke, which I think are really beautiful.
Love is something difficult and it is more difficult than other things because in other conflicts nature herself enjoins men to collect themselves, to take themselves firmly in the hand with all their strength, while in the heightening of love the impulse is to give oneself wholly away. (from Letters to a Young Poet)
...let happy memories sustain you if your strength fails you, they are always there, and their current does not run backwards, even across foggy country it floats toward the future. (from Selected Letters of Rainer Maria Rilke)
